No, "beauty" is not a collective noun. It is an abstract noun that refers to the quality or state of being beautiful, rather than denoting a group of individuals or items. Collective nouns are terms like "team" or "flock," which represent a collection of entities. In contrast, "beauty" encapsulates a singular concept or characteristic.

What is the collective noun in 'The beauty of these trees amazes crowds every day'?

There is no collective noun in that sentence.A collective noun is a noun used to group people or things in a descriptive or a fanciful way.The standard collective nouns for trees are:a stand of treesa grove of treesan orchard of treesa forest of treesa copse of treesExample sentence: The grove of trees amazes crowds every day.
